Budget 2025: The middle class of the country rejoiced after hearing the budget, salary up to 12 lakhs is tax-free; how much loss will the government incur?
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man has made a big announcement for taxpayers while presenting the budget today. The Finance Minister said that income up to Rs 12 lakh will be completely tax-free. The middle-class people of the country have breathed a sigh of relief with this announcement of the Finance Minister.
